4. Overlooking the Wagering Requirements
Many players forget about the wagering requirements attached to bonuses. Bounty Casino typically enforces a **35x** wagering requirement on specific bonuses before you can withdraw any winnings generated from them. This means if you received a bonus of £100, you’d need to wager a total of **£3,500** before your funds become available for withdrawal. Always read the terms and conditions to understand what you’re up against before attempting to cash out.
